CHÂTEAU DE TERRIDE, A BOLD BLEND OF LOVE FOR THE LAND

Château de Terride
It was the current winemaker Alix's parents who first fell in love with this former hunting estate in 1996. The second love affair was that of Alix and Romain, who now bring the estate to life through their two unique personalities. This Château, full of history and charm, sits on a domain with an aesthetic reminiscent of the landscapes of Tuscany, Italy. Just minutes from the town of Gaillac, this estate is cultivated with taste and offers numerous AOP Gaillac cuvées.
Alix and Romain: Boldness and Gastronomy
The estate's love story doesn't stop there. The uniqueness of Château de Terride lies in being guided by two maestros.
Alix is a bold winemaker proud of her heritage and region. She is committed to preserving the exceptional environment by cultivating the vineyard organically and defending local heritage at every opportunity. Her boldness is reflected in her cuvées named "Caprice d'Alix," where she works with rare Gaillac grape varieties such as Viognier and Grenache. Her cuvées are generous, daring, and modern.
Romain is a lover of gastronomy and food-wine pairings. He seeks to evoke strong emotions through the various cuvées he enjoys pairing during events he organizes at the estate.
The Vineyard of Château: An Exceptional Heritage
Located on the edge of the Gresigne Forest, the estate is part of a protected zone. It spans approximately thirty-four hectares. The cultivated grape varieties are primarily red: eighty percent of the vineyard is dedicated to red wines, notably Duras, Syrah, and Braucol. The remaining twenty percent is devoted to white wines, with Mauzac and Loin de l’Oeil as the main varieties.
